Curriculum Corner: Tennessee Science Standards Updated

Posted on Mar 19, 2019

This school year the Tennessee Science standards change! All of the 4-H lesson plans for in-school clubs that have science standards have now been updated and are posted on the in-school clubs website! You will find a summary and link for each below.
